Output 59db121a655299013d566c662c86fe3bd17b4a3702c495222c0f021f9f8cb03a: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c0acedb492d881dbc65cec78a9d43eacdd2808aa580b92982e48ddf10109974c
address
tb1pczkwmdyjmzqah3jua3u2n4p74nwjsz92tq9e9xpwfrwlzqgfjaxqzeshe0
transaction
59db121a655299013d566c662c86fe3bd17b4a3702c495222c0f021f9f8cb03a
confirmations
66001
spent
true